Ambuja Cements is planning to set up a captive power plant of 50 MW in Marwar Mundwa in Nagaur district of Rajasthan. The project cost is estimated at Rs. 3000 million.
Avante Garde Infrastructure is setting up a 2×400 MW gas based combined cycle Power Plant at village Atru, in Atru Taluk, in Baran District in Rajasthan. Land requirement for the project will be 100 acres, which is available as waste land. Natural Gas requirement will be 4.0 MMSCMD. Water requirement will be 24000 KLD, which will be obtained from Parvati River through a pipeline over a distance of 8.0 km from the project site. The company has signed the MOU with GAIL for gas supply and transportation.

Rajasthan Rajya Vidyut Prasaran Nigam Ltd is setting up a 1000 MW gas based thermal power project in Keshoraipatan in Bundi district in Rajasthan. A new company in the name & style of Keshorai Patan Thermal Power Ltd has been floated to implement the project. The company has acquired land for this project. The project was announced in December 2009 with a capacity of 1,000 MW. The State Government approval was received in July 2010. It will entail an investment of Rs..4,000 crore. Fuel requirement will be 5.1 MMSCMD of natural gas and sourced from GAIL gas pipeline. Water requirement will be 2.62 MCM, which will be sourced from the Chambal River through a pipeline about a distance of 27 km from the project site. The project is likely to go operational in July 2014.
